Perfectly positioned close to the centre of Alresford, with its delightful array of shops, cafés and amenities, this beautifully presented three-bedroom home combines character and modern comfort. Thoughtfully extended, the property offers generous and versatile living space with an easy flow throughout.

The welcoming entrance hall opens into a spacious kitchen/dining room overlooking the pretty rear garden. The elegant sitting room features a charming bay window with a window seat, creating a light-filled and relaxing space. Completing the ground floor is a versatile study/library and a practical cloakroom/utility room.

Upstairs, the dual-aspect principal bedroom is wonderfully bright, complemented by two further double bedrooms and a bath/shower room.

Outside, the property boasts an attractive front garden and a lovely rear garden with raised beds and a terraced area—ideal for summer entertaining. At the end of the garden sits a wider than average garage, accommodating a smaller car and offering loft space with potential for conversion into a studio or workshop.

Alresford is a beautiful Georgian town known for its variety of independent shops, restaurants and inns located in stunning surroundings on the edge of the South Downs National Park. Attractions include the Watercress steam railway, schools for infant, junior and secondary education, several churches and an active and inclusive community. The cathedral city of Winchester is about 7 miles away and there is easy access to the south coast, the midlands and London via the road network. There is also mainline rail access to London from both Winchester and Alton. Southampton airport is only about half an hour away by car.
